Overview
F11 – Municipal Grants Program Policy Guidelines provides municipal grant support for eligible community organizations in Leamington. It funds community initiatives and in-kind assistance, with applications submitted electronically through the Municipality’s Finance and Business Services Department.

Activities funded
- Community projects, programs, and events
- Public initiatives that improve community well-being
- In-kind municipal support initiatives
Documents Needed
- Completed application form
- Supporting documents listed in the application
- Prior years financial statements, for community partner donations
Official resources
Eligibility
Who is eligible?
- Non-profit organizations
- Not-for-profit organizations
- Community groups
Eligible expenses
- Financial assistance for approved community initiatives
- In-kind assistance through municipal property, facilities, materials, or resources
- Funding for the specific purpose stated in the application
Ineligible Costs and Activities
- Applications submitted late or incomplete
- Initiatives that have been reviewed and denied twice
- Funding requested for purposes outside the approved initiative
Eligible geographic areas
- Municipality of Leamington
Selection criteria
- Community benefit and scale
- Inclusivity and direct or indirect benefits
- Soundness of the business plan and financial stability
- Importance of the Municipality’s contribution
- Ability to measure success
How to apply
- Step 1: Check the application period
- Review the annual timeline posted on the Municipality’s website.
- Step 2: Complete the electronic application
- Fill out the online application form.
- Attach the documents required by the form.
- Step 3: Submit to Finance and Business Services
- Send the completed application electronically to the Municipality.
- Step 4: Await review and notification
- The Committee reviews the application and makes a recommendation to Council.
- Applicants are notified of the decision.
Processing and Agreement
- Applications are reviewed by the Municipal Grants Review Committee.
- The Committee recommends applications to Council for eligibility and approval.
- Council makes the final decision.
- Applicants are notified of the decision.
- Approved applicants are contacted by Finance and Business Services when payment is available.
Additional information
- Applications are submitted electronically.
- Application dates are published on the City’s website.
- Grant decisions are final.
- Approved organizations must sign a Letter of Agreement before payment.
